Riassunto:The present work of legal research is entitled "THE CHAIN ​​OF CUSTODY IN THE DUE PROCESS AND ITS PROBATORY EFFECTIVENESS IN CRIMINAL LAW", dogmatizing that the chain of custody, in a few simple words, is the form by means of which it is assured that the judicial decisions are based on the truthful and duly collected evidence, being of utmost importance the existence of a systematization of norms and principles in the Chain of Custody Manual, as well as in the Ecuadorian Code of Criminal Procedure. Currently there is no section that deals specifically and in detail with the chain of custody procedure, but rather this important issue is scarcely mentioned in a manual of lesser order, which has the consequence that it is difficult to understand its true dimension in practice. As expected, this gap regarding the chain of custody, generates ignorance about what is the proper and correct procedure to handle evidence and / or evidence, which in turn has as a consequence that there are abuses and injuries against the procedural guarantees. The present investigation intends to "Propose a Reform to the Chain of Custody Manual", determining the appropriate procedure for the collection, packaging, labeling, transfer and storage of the evidence or evidence, with the sole and primary purpose of safeguarding the constitutional right to due process as well as to exercise legality on the evidence collected, guaranteeing legal effectiveness in the criminal process
